Gear-Driven Sprinkler Systems for Optimal Lawn Watering
Wiki Article
When it comes to watering your grassland, efficiency is key. A gear drive sprinkler system can be a fantastic choice for providing your plants with the necessary moisture while minimizing water waste. Unlike traditional impact sprinklers, which rely on force to propel water, gear drive systems utilize rotating gears to distribute water in a controlled and accurate manner. This method ensures that your lawn receives consistent coverage, reducing the risk of overwatering in some areas and underwatering in others.
- Furthermore, gear drive sprinklers are known for their longevity. They are built with robust components designed to withstand the elements and provide years of reliable service.
- Consequently, if you're seeking a water-efficient and dependable solution for your lawn irrigation needs, a gear drive sprinkler system is definitely worth evaluating.

Rotary Sprinklers: Delivering Even Coverage for Large Areas
For sprawling lawns and expansive gardens, achieving uniform watering can feel a challenge. Rotary sprinklers|Rotating sprinklers|Circular sprinklers offer a effective solution by delivering even coverage to large areas. These sprinklers feature a rotating nozzle that sends water in a wide arc, forming a gentle rain-like pattern. With adjustable radius settings and spray patterns, you can customise the sprinkler's performance to match your exact watering needs.
The movement of the nozzle ensures that water covers every corner of the area, stopping dry patches and promoting healthy plant growth. Additionally, their efficient design helps to save water usage, making them an environmentally friendly choice for responsible gardening.

Choosing the Ideal Sprinkler System for Your Lawn
To truly enhance your irrigation system's efficiency, sprinkler selection is paramount. Different sprinkler models are created to address specific moisture needs and yard features. Consider elements like your lawn's area, the configuration of your property, and the types of grass you cultivate. A well- selected sprinkler system will distribute water consistently across your lawn, promoting healthy growth and conserving precious resources.
- Evaluate your lawn's watering requirements based on its size, slope, and soil type.
- Research various sprinkler types, like rotary, impact, and spray sprinklers, to figure out the best fit for your goals.
- Seek advice from irrigation professionals to obtain personalized recommendations regarding your specific lawn.
